It’s snowing. Dive in.

Whether the slopes are ripe with fluff or steeped in slush, The North Face Women’s Inlux Insulated Jacket will keep you dry. The HyVent 2L shell and fully taped seams block water while letting perspiration escape, so you’ll never feel soggy. Synthetic insulation cranks up the warmth on frosty mountain days.
  • Underarm zippers let hot, muggy air out and fresh air in
  • Fleece on collar prevents chafing
  • Fleece on upper body lining creates extra warmth where you need it most
  • Fully sealed seams prevent water from sneaking through the most vulnerable stitching
  • Heatseeker insulation traps warmth without adding unnecessary bulk

Love this jacket!! I have 2 of them! My first one was a small in Gravity Purple, then I purchased a medium black one. I am 5'6" and 125lbs. The small is a good size but I went with the medium this time because you can layer a hoodie under it more comfortably. The sleeves are a perfect length. And also the length! I definitely recommend this jacket! Its SO warm. I'm from Michigan so I'm used to below freezing temps! I absolutely love it!:)

This is a very beautiful jacket! I plan to use it as a ski jacket this year. I'm 5'2" and 125lbs and I bought the medium. Originally I bought a small, but it seemed a bit constricting with a thick fleece underneath. If you plan to use it for winter sports, I'd size up. For casual wear, a small would have been fine since I'm usually a S/XS in NF gear. I got the Premiere Purple, which is more purple-y (and less pink!) than the photo here lets on. It's warm, but definitely not as warm as a down parka. A good deal, especially if you can buy it during one of Backcountry's many amazing sales!

I am 5'5" and 140lbs I have this jacket in size medium and it fits perfect!!! The octopus blue is gorgeous, a bright blue-green (more blue) I even fit a thin fleece under it. It has cozy soft insulation and pit zips. I only wish that I could zip in a liner, it does not have the inner zipper for that. I chose this over the closer jacket ( after much thought as I wanted a liner jacket as well which this one does NOT have, but the closer triclimate does have and I liked the solid color more on the Inlux) I ordered the north face bomber hoodie in the same color too. The length is just below my waist and it has a great hood and pockets too!! This will be great for the Maine winters here on the coast.
